Painting Description
"Underwater Garden" (German: "Unterwasser-Garten") is a watercolor painting by Swiss-German artist Paul Klee, created in 1920. This work is part of Klee's extensive oeuvre, which is characterized by his innovative use of color and form, and his exploration of the subconscious through abstract and semi-abstract compositions. Klee, a member of the early 20th-century avant-garde movement and associated with expressionism, cubism, and surrealism, often drew inspiration from dreams, music, and poetry, which is reflected in the dreamlike quality of "Underwater Garden."
The painting features a whimsical, underwater scene that is typical of Klee's playful and imaginative approach to art. The use of watercolor in "Underwater Garden" allows for a translucent and fluid quality, reminiscent of the aquatic environment it represents. Klee's mastery in layering colors to create depth and his use of line to guide the viewer's eye through the composition are evident in this piece. The artwork's title suggests a natural, submerged setting, where organic forms and aquatic elements intermingle, possibly alluding to the growth and mystery of the subconscious mind.
"Underwater Garden" is part of Klee's creative period during his time at the Bauhaus, a revolutionary school of art, architecture, and design in Germany. During this time, Klee's work was influential in developing the school's curriculum, particularly in color theory and visual arts. The painting is an example of Klee's pedagogical interest in the relationship between nature and art, and how the artist can abstract natural forms to reveal underlying patterns and structures.
As with many of Klee's works, "Underwater Garden" is held in high regard for its contribution to modern art and for its embodiment of the artist's personal philosophy and aesthetic. The painting is part of a larger body of Klee's work that continues to be studied and celebrated for its originality, depth, and enduring influence on contemporary art.
